I was thinking of this as an end, probably because I try to make composition entries have a distinct close rather than a fade out, but looking at it again, it would take very little change to make it 'open'.

PS
Those pads are from four of my Zyn voices played synchonously but at different pitches: Ice Field, Breathy Pad, Smooth, Full Strings

This is then passed though an instance of jamin with a 7dB notch at 800 Hz. It is a synth sound I've been trying to achieve for a very long time!
